Mike, I have win98, but maybe your beeps are like mine, and if so you could check two things - first, is it possible that a certain site is open when this occurs? There is a game site I go to sometimes and I didn't realize it for some time because I generally have a lot of windows open, but every now and then when it is open I hear an odd sound. I finally figured it out -I never hear it if that site is not open. Like many such sites that site adds spyware to my computer so I run adaware after I shut it. The other thing I did to find an odd sound once was open "sounds" in my control panel. If you do that you will find a little speaker icon next to each function that currently has a sound associated with it. It may take a bit of time, but if you go down the list and play each sound until you hear that particular beep then you can disable it if you like. There are a number of things my computer does that I don't really need an alert about, and some I do. On that list I have assigned sounds to those I wish to hear and made sure there is no sound for the ones I don't care about.
